Testicular biopsies in 1982 demonstrated that children as young as 10 showed tubular and interstitial changes similar to adults, suggesting that damage begins early. 3. Clinical Classification (The Three Degrees)
Unlike today, where Doppler ultrasonography is standard, the use of imaging in 1982 was reserved for complex cases. Diagnosis was a clinical art, dependent on the experienced hands of the pediatric surgeon or urologist.
